How to book the cheapest flight to Kairouan?
As every experienced jet-setter knows, avoid booking at the last minute. Prices are usually more expensive just prior to the departure date. Another fantastic way to grab the best deal is to shop around. If where you're headed has a few airports, don't forget to research the cost of flying into a less busy terminal. Finally, be prepared to lock in your seat quickly if you find a real bargain. It might not be available for long! With a bit of knowledge and some good fortune, the ideal fare will be yours.
How to survive the flight to Kairouan?
If you're not prepared, airports and flying can be daunting. But there's no need to worry. Follow these useful tips for a pleasant start to your time in Kairouan.What to pack in your hand luggage:

  • First, pack your passport, travel documents, credit cards and daily medications. Next, you'll need some in-flight entertainment to help pass the time. A juicy book and a laptop crammed with your favorite shows are always good options. If you intend to take a quick snooze, a neck pillow and a pair of noise-canceling headphones will also come in handy. Finally, leave some space for a toothbrush and some deodorant so you'll arrive feeling fresh as a daisy.

Do not pack the following items in your hand luggage:

  • While the list of restricted items differs between airlines, the general rule of thumb is nothing flammable, sharp or explosive. This includes screwdrivers, pocket knives, spray paint and flares. Sporting equipment like baseball bats, and items that could harm other people, such as pepper spray and firearms, are also banned from the cabin.

What to wear on a flight:

  • Comfort should always be your prime concern when selecting what to wear on board. Consider your footwear carefully too, as swollen feet and ankles are quite common. Slightly roomy, flat shoes are always a sensible way to go.
  • Unfortunately, a risk of long-distance flying is developing DVT (deep vein thrombosis), a blood clot condition caused by prolonged inactivity. To prevent this from happening, take every opportunity to wander around the cabin. Compression tights and socks are another great idea to help minimize this risk.

How to get through airport security fast when flying to Kairouan?
Being organized before your flight will make your trip to Kairouan a pleasure. We've compiled some top tips for a speedy journey past security:

  • Have your passport and travel documents close by. They're the first things you'll be asked for by security.
  • Time to strip down. Well sort of. Your belt, jacket, keys and other small items, like coins, will be required to go through the X-ray machine. Make the whole process faster by removing them as it gets closer to your turn.
  • For just a few moments, you'll need to unplug from technology. Your phone, tablet and any other electronic gadgets also need to be sent through the scanner.
  • Don't forget to remove liquids and gels from your carry-on bag. They often need to be sent through the X-ray separately. Each product should be in a container no larger than 3.4 ounces (100 milliliters) and everything must fit inside a quart-size (one liter), clear zip-lock bag.
  • Slip-on shoes are a practical footwear choice as you're less likely to have to remove them when going through security. Boots and other heavy shoes are usually subjected to extra screening.
  • Take all prohibited items out of your carry-on bag. If you have any sharp or pointed objects, put them in your checked baggage. They won't be allowed in the cabin.
